Compare performance (490 HP vs 218 HP), boot space and price (45900 £ vs 41300 £ ) at a glance. Find out which car is the better choice for you – NIO EL6 or Aiways U6?
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.
Aiways U6 has a slightly advantage in terms of price – it starts at 41300 £ , while the NIO EL6 costs 45900 £ . That’s a price difference of around 4562 £.
In terms of energy consumption, the advantage goes to the Aiways U6: with 15.90 kWh per 100 km, it’s clearly perceptible more efficient than the NIO EL6 with 20.40 kWh. That’s a difference of about 4.50 kWh.
As for electric range, the NIO EL6 performs evident better – achieving up to 529 km, about 124 km more than the Aiways U6.
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.
When it comes to engine power, the NIO EL6 has a significantly edge – offering 490 HP compared to 218 HP. That’s roughly 272 HP more horsepower.
In ac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h, the NIO EL6 is decisively quicker – completing the sprint in 4.50 s, while the Aiways U6 takes 7 s. That’s about 2.50 s faster.
In terms of top speed, the NIO EL6 performs somewhat better – reaching 200 km/h, while the Aiways U6 tops out at 160 km/h. The difference is around 40 km/h.
There’s also a difference in torque: NIO EL6 pulls convincingly stronger with 700 Nm compared to 315 Nm. That’s about 385 Nm difference.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In curb weight, Aiways U6 is clearly perceptible lighter – 1790 kg compared to 2215 kg. The difference is around 425 kg.
In terms of boot space, the NIO EL6 offers evident more room – 597 L compared to 472 L. That’s a difference of about 125 L.
In maximum load capacity, the NIO EL6 performs a bit better – up to 1430 L, which is about 170 L more than the Aiways U6.
When it comes to payload, NIO EL6 to a small extent takes the win – 475 kg compared to 405 kg. That’s a difference of about 70 kg.
The NIO EL6 is far ahead overall in the objective data comparison.

The NIO EL6 blends coupe-like styling with a spacious, tech-packed cabin that makes it feel more premium than its price tag suggests. It steers with quiet confidence and clever conveniences — including NIO's battery-swap option — so long trips start to feel like pure driving pleasure rather than logistical planning.
